## Runbook: Session-Token Refresh Bug

Heads up: the Torchpine auth proxy sometimes hands out refresh tokens that expire before the access token does. Users get bounced to login mid-session. Quick fix: flush the token cache on the affected node and force a re-mint via the Mintworks admin endpoint. The endpoint needs service-level auth, not your personal login, so use the key below.

gateway credential: kto23_LX9A4ys6i4nzHtpOLNLodKK

## Runbook: Squatterling scanner stalls

If the Squatterling typo-squat scanner stops emitting alerts, first check the Pindle registry mirror — it's almost always a stale feed. Restart the fetcher, wait ten minutes, and confirm new package names flow. Before filing anything, grab the scanner's current trace token, shown below.

pipeline stamp: htk9_ce63042d9

Handover — Crispwheel Restock Planner. Hi Delun, passing this to you for on-call. The route optimizer for the Harbrook vending cluster is mid-migration; nightly planning jobs run at 02:10 and must not overlap with the inventory sync. If the planner's config store locks after a failed deploy (it did twice this week), you'll need to re-open it manually. The recovery passphrase is below.

unlock words, fahop-yageg: ralwyn-kelath

- [ ] Step 7: Archive cold storage buckets (Glacierline tier). Confirm both ceremony witnesses are present, verify bucket manifests match the Oxbow ledger, then seal the archive key shares. Plugin authors may observe but not handle shares. Once sealed, the archive index itself is encrypted and can only be reopened with the passphrase below.

vault phrase of badup-hahig = tamael-aldael-kelmir-istael-fenok-istwyn-tamius-jorath-oliion